冲突编辑工具Beyond Compare的使用

提交代码到git库中,难免会出现冲突,导师推荐我使用Beyond  Compare软件编辑冲突,比上次git培训室讲的用git原生的编辑冲突工具好用好多。

代码push之后,创建PR,提示有冲突时,只需要几步就可以简单解决冲突:


1.将远程与自己刚才提交的代码冲突的分支代码pull到本地(与哪个分支冲突就拉哪个冲突到本地)

进入目录——>pull——>在remoto brach 切换冲突分支。


2.再次提交代码会提示冲突文件,显示红色,标记为conflict。

右键——>commit——>找到冲突对应的文件,双击打开(安装Beyond  Compare之后,默认使用Beyond  Compare工具打开)

3.编辑冲突

中间是local本地代码,最右边是remoto远程代码,最下面是最后编辑完以后的代码。ctrl+n快速定位到下一个冲突。


4.标记为resolved

编辑完成后,关闭,提示saved,并右键选择resolved。


如果想要用自己的代码全部替换直接右键选择resolved using mine,用别人的代码替换自己的直接右键选择resolved using theirs

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值